ARGENTINA – Inn-to-Inn – The Great Pampas Ride [Print This Tour Print This Tour ]

Country: Argentina

The legendary pampas is the cradle of the “gauchos.” Your day is filled will pristine and endless landscapes; your evenings with the brilliant stars of the southern hemisphere. Hearty Argentine meals and barbecues will be complimented with wines from the “terroirs” including the world renowned Argentine Malbecs. Immersed in the Argentine culture, you will entertained by the mythic stories of the gauchos, and surprised at your ability to tango. This ride has been featured on National Geographic and Animal Planet.

ITINERARY

pampas2Day 1:
Transfer to the Estancia from the Buenos Aires Airport. After you are settled and have enjoyed lunch, you will become acquainted with your horse as you hack across the 3,000 acres of the Estancia.

Day 2 – 4:
You will ride across the famous pampas grasslands, enjoy long canters on the plains, walk along the El Gato River banks and explore quaint and charming villages. The gauchos will teach you the “secrets” of cattle work and horse breeding. An opportunity to drive a 19th century carriage is yours. You will mingle with the locals after you tie your horse in front of the Almada pub and go inside for a drink.

pampas3Day 5:
After a morning of riding, you will be taken to Buenos Aires, the “Paris of South America. You are free to meander through the city, shop and visit the museums.

Day 6:
After you settle in your hotel, you will tour the city and learn about unique landmarks like the Plaza de Mayo and Casa Rosada’s balcony. In the evening, you will attend a tango show and take a tango lesson at Complejo Tango.

Day 7:
You will explore the River Plate. The local Indians call the water “as big as the sea” as it is second in size to the Amazon. You will visit picturesque riverside towns and enjoy breathtaking views of thousands of islands within the Paraná delta. At 2:30 PM, you will return to your hotel to prepare for your transfer to the airport.

Details:

Dates: 2012: March 4-10, April 22-28, June 24-30, August 12-18, September 16-22, November 18-24 (Palermo Polo Open time period), December 26-January 1st (New Year celebration ride) 2013 March 10-16, April 7-13, June 2-8, June 23-29, August 18-24 (Tango Festival), September 15-21, November 17-23, December 26-January 1                           
Riding days: 5
Meeting Point: Buenos Aires International Airport
Riding ability: Walk, trot, canter, opportunity to gallop
Horses: Argentine Creoles
Group size: 2 – 10
Saddles: South American Recede
Non- riding activities: no
Hotel/s: 5***** hotel and estancia guest house
Special Events: January 3 – Dakar Rally, March 30 – Largest horse show in Latin America: Nuestros Caballos in Buenos Aires, August 6 – Buenos Aires Tango Festival
Price: $1,850 p.p, double occupancy for 6 or more riders booked, $1,950 if 4-5 riders booked, $2,100 if 2-3 riders booked $410 single supplement
*Pricing adjustment will be made once final group number is confirmed. Contact for details.

Includes: 2 nights hotel in Buenos Aires, 4 nights in the Estancia, all meals and beverages (wine, soft drinks, water), guide, transfers to and from airport

Not included: Airfare
